California Estate Planning Laws & Deadlines

California estate planning operates under the comprehensive California Probate Code, which governs wills, trusts, and estate administration. The state requires specific formalities for valid wills, including witness requirements, and offers streamlined procedures for smaller estates under $184,500. California also recognizes community property laws that significantly impact estate planning strategies for married couples.

What are California's requirements for a valid will?
California requires wills to be in writing, signed by the testator, and witnessed by two disinterested parties who also sign in the testator's presence. Alternatively, California recognizes handwritten holographic wills that don't require witnesses but must be entirely in the testator's handwriting and signed.
